Learn creative and inexpensive ways to promote your collection of poetry.
This workshop will provide ideas and suggestions for promoting your new collection of poetry. Courtney LeBlanc is the author of four full length collections of poetry and for her 3rd collection she went on a self-organized book tour that encompassed 9 months, 18 states, and 64 readings. Not only is this an impressive feat, but she *made money* on her book tour! She’ll share her tips and tricks for promoting your work without feeling icky doing it.
